Sun Devils lose another starter to injury

The Columbian
Published: September 19, 2011, 5:00pm

TEMPE, Ariz. (AP) — Arizona State starting defensive end Junior Onyeali (on-yay-lee) is expected to miss at least six weeks due to torn knee cartilage.

Onyeali, the Pac-12 defensive freshman of the year last season, was injured in the first quarter of the Sun Devils’ 17-14 loss at Illinois on Saturday.

Arizona State coach Dennis Erickson said Onyeali will have surgery on Thursday after an MRI revealed a torn meniscus. Onyeali could be out for the season if the damage is extensive enough.

The Sun Devils have already been hit hard by injuries, losing cornerback Omar Bolden and receiver T.J. Simpson to torn ACLs in the spring, and linebacker Brandon Magee to a torn Achilles tendon in the preseason.
